Every December, a listing of bad passwords is published by SplashData, and that 12 months the menu of the worst passwords of 2017 offers the exact same horrors as ages gone-by. Passwords that not only would get a hacker alongside almost no time to imagine, but in lots of cases, maybe damaged from the very first attempt.

The list of the worst passwords of 2017 try put together from sources of leaked and stolen passwords which were published on line throughout 2017.

The minimum code size on many web sites has been risen up to eight characters; however, it continues to be possible to make use of passwords of six figures in a lot of areas. This current year, the worst password is actually six figures extended and it is the acutely unimaginative: 123456. A password really easy to think, really scarcely worth place a password anyway.

In second room try an eight-character code, that will be in the same way perhaps not worth utilizing at all: code. In third location is actually 12345678. Those three passwords kept similar opportunities as this past year.

Each and every year, the exact same passwords appear on the list, with small variations inside their roles in the listing. But there are many new entries this year. The rebooting associated with Star conflicts saga have spurred lots of people to select Superstar battles related passwords, with starwars featuring in 16 th situation from the list.

A fascinating entryway makes it into 25 th put aˆ“ trustno1. Helpful advice, but despite the addition of a variety, it’s still an undesirable code solution. At first glance, numbers 24 in the number appears to be affordable, but qazwsx may be the first six figures on the left-hand area of the keyboard.

Utilising the passwords letmein, podłączenie beetalk passw0rd, admin, master, and whatever, are equally worst. All of those words make leading 25 into the directory of the worst passwords of 2017.

The menu of the worst passwords of 2017 discloses lots of people are incredibly unimaginative when selecting a password to protect their unique mail, social media marketing, and online accounts.

SplashData estimates 3percent of individuals purchased the worst password in the number, while 10% have used one of the primary 25 passwords to aˆ?secureaˆ? at least one online account.

A lot of people know strings of consecutive data were bad, as is any variety of the phrase code, but altering to a dictionary phrase or a pop music lifestyle resource is equally as poor, as Morgan Slain, Chief Executive Officer of SplashData, Inc., revealed, aˆ?Hackers are utilizing typical terminology from pop community and activities to-break into profile on-line because they discover so many people are making use of those easy-to-remember statement.aˆ?

This means making use of sports (or any other athletics) or starwars will likely not avoid a hacker from gaining usage of an account for lengthy.

The thing that makes a terrible Code?

Brute power problems, those in which continued efforts are made to imagine passwords, doesn’t require a hacker seated at a personal computer entering terrible passwords until the correct you’re thought. Those problems were carried out by spiders, and it does not take long for a bot to guess an unhealthy code.

Without rates limiting aˆ“ position an optimum many failed efforts before access is actually briefly clogged aˆ“ to reduce the processes, the spiders can cycle through set of the worst passwords of 2017 quickly, with those included in various other years alongside dictionary phrase.

Hackers additionally understand the tricks that folks used to keep passwords an easy task to keep in mind, while meeting the stronger code criteria ready because of it divisions, instance adding a description mark into end of an easy to consider word or changing particular letters the help of its numerical equivalent: an A with a 4, or an O with a zero as an example.
